Recipe card for Muslim style Biryani prepared on wedding:
INGREDIENTS:
750gm Basmati rice
750 gm mutton
2 tbsp Oil
5 Onions
2-3 cardamom
4-5 cloves
2 Cinnamon stick
1 bay leaf
2 tbsp Ginger garlic paste
2 1/2 tsp Red chilli powder
3-4 Green chilies
5 Chopped tomatoes
3 tsp Malai
Salt to taste
1 Cup Curd
INSTRUCTIONS:
- Wash and soak rice for atleast 30 mins
- In a deep bottom pan add oil, Cinnamon stick, cardamom, cloves and bay leaf fry for a minute until it turns aromatic,
- Add sliced onions saute until light golden brown.
- Add ginger garlic paste saute until raw smell of ginger and garlic goes away.
- Now add mutton and green chilies fry for a minute until mutton changes its color.
- Add red chili powder fry until oil separate from sides of a pan.
- Add chopped tomatoes saute until tomatoes turns tender.
- In a blender add curd and malai blend smoothly.
- Add coriander leaves and mint leaves to the mutton gravy.
- While mutton is on a low flame gradually add curd mix well add some water. cover the lid until mutton cooks well.
- In another vessel boil water add salt and soak rice cook the rice until 90% done.
- Drain off the excess water.
- Add rice to the mutton mix slightly.
- Add ghee. Cover and steam cook for 15 minutes.
- Let it sit for another 5 minutes without flame.
- Serve hot with onion raita and Brinjal.
